Direct Synthesis of High‐Valence Protein@UiO‐66 Composites: Linking Crystallization Pathways to Protein Encapsulation

open access: yesAdvanced Materials, EarlyView.
This work reports a direct, biocompatible method to synthesize UiO‐66, enabling one‐step encapsulation of proteins without compromising crystallinity or activity. Using advanced in situ and ex situ techniques, the study reveals that proteins integrate concurrently with MOF growth, forming crystalline protein@UiO‐66 nanoparticles, and provide insight ...

Numerical Simulation of Radiative Heat Transfer

47th AIAA Aerospace Sciences Meeting including The New Horizons Forum and Aerospace Exposition, 2009
Radiative heat transfer is an important physical phenomenon especially in the high speed and high temperature flow regime making its application important in space exploration vehicles. This paper presents the development and validation of computational tools for modeling the radiative heat transfer with an aim that the developed numerical module can ...

Radiative Transfer Simulations of AGN Dust Tori

EAS Publications Series, 2008
The presence of dust tori in active galactic nuclei (AGN) lies at the heart of AGN unification schemes. The dominating inner part of the tori can only be resolved by infrared interferometry. Here we discuss the present state of torus models and the radiative transfer methods to simulate the infrared SEDs and visibilities for comparison with actual ...
